Transaction df121cc01bca681573a2251061a0236bfda7e105148c8d1689aface27cbfb8c7
1 Input
1 Output
-
df121cc01bca681573a2251061a0236bfda7e105148c8d1689aface27cbfb8c7:0
- value
- 67324891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49612912371849658466bc035cc7d28da37cccaf OP_EQUAL
- address
- MEb9xFyxJ4eLcW7QycrhhQZqjqhVrjbS1T